MOV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2023 in Review

148 of the 6,859 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Movado Group (MOV) for Q4 2023, worth a combined $464M — up 18% from $393M a quarter earlier.

Fund positioning in MOV was balanced in Q4 2023: 19 funds opened new positions, 19 closed out, 55 added to existing stakes and 50 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Pacer Advisors, adding an estimated $6.74M. The largest seller was Acadian Asset Management, cutting an estimated $2.7M.
